7 votes

Quelle est la meilleure façon d'analyser un disque dur/vérifier son état dans Ubuntu ?

J'ai fait une recherche au préalable et je ne pense pas qu'une question similaire ait été posée auparavant.

J'ai deux disques durs - un Seagate de 1 To et un Western Digital de 1 To. Mon disque Seagate est tombé en panne il y a quelque temps et je pense qu'il a peut-être des secteurs endommagés. Je me demandais simplement quelle était la meilleure façon d'effectuer un scan du disque dur dans Ubuntu et de vérifier la santé du disque dur en général ? Je sais que Seagate et WD fournissent leurs propres logiciels pour scanner et réparer les disques durs - peuvent-ils être installés dans Ubuntu ? Si non, quelqu'un peut-il me dire quelle méthode est recommandée ? Ou bien, est-il préférable d'utiliser le logiciel propriétaire du fabricant via Windows ?

4voto

Time4Tea Points 265

J'ai lu un peu plus sur ce sujet moi-même. Ces deux pages donnent quelques conseils sur l'analyse des disques durs/systèmes de fichiers sous Linux (elles mentionnent également les points suivants fsck y badblocks ) :

http://www.howtogeek.com/howto/37659/the-beginners-guide-to-linux-disk-utilities/

http://mypage.uniserve.ca/~thelinuxguy/doc/hdtest.html

Il existe également le paquet Ubuntu 'Disk Utility', qui permet de vérifier le statut SMART du disque dur.

3voto

krowe Points 423

Une analyse standard du système de fichiers est généralement effectuée avec fsck . Cette application gère d'emblée la plupart des systèmes de fichiers. Cependant, vous devrez peut-être installer Support NTFS séparément sur certaines installations.

Si vous souhaitez effectuer un balayage de surface de votre lecteur, vous pouvez utiliser e2fsck . Utilisez le -c pour effectuer une analyse des secteurs défectueux.

Il convient également de mentionner que presque toutes les distributions Linux sont également configurées par défaut pour analyser périodiquement vos disques fixes au démarrage. Elles sont aussi généralement configurées pour effectuer cette opération selon un calendrier (ceci est important car la plupart des machines Linux ont rarement besoin d'être réinitialisées).

3voto

yPhil Points 1357

Vous pouvez utiliser la commande smartctl du paquet smartmontools :

sudo apt install smartmontools
sudo smartctl -a /dev/sda

/dev/sda est le nom du périphérique que vous souhaitez numériser.

SistemesEz.com

SystemesEZ est une communauté de sysadmins où vous pouvez résoudre vos problèmes et vos doutes. Vous pouvez consulter les questions des autres sysadmins, poser vos propres questions ou résoudre celles des autres.

Powered by:

X